Cách cập nhật dữ liệu từ cơ sở dữ liệu trong PHP bằng nút
Hướng dẫn này cho biết cách lưu dữ liệu biểu mẫu vào cơ sở dữ liệu MySQL bằng PHP. Một sự hiểu biết cơ bản của cả hai là cần thiết Show Bắt đầu nào
Ghi chú. Quá trình tạo hoặc chỉnh sửa cơ sở dữ liệu của bạn sẽ phụ thuộc vào thiết lập máy chủ hoặc máy chủ lưu trữ web của bạn. Liên hệ với bộ phận hỗ trợ của nhà cung cấp của bạn để được hỗ trợ Tạo, chỉnh sửa, cập nhật và xóa nội dung trên trang web là những gì làm cho trang web năng động. Đó là những gì chúng ta sẽ làm trong bài viết này. Người dùng truy cập trang web của chúng tôi sẽ có thể tạo các bài đăng sẽ được lưu trong cơ sở dữ liệu mysql, truy xuất các bài đăng từ cơ sở dữ liệu và hiển thị chúng trên trang web. Mỗi bài đăng sẽ được hiển thị với một nút chỉnh sửa và xóa để cho phép người dùng cập nhật bài đăng cũng như xóa chúng Đầu tiên, tạo một cơ sở dữ liệu có tên là crud. Trong cơ sở dữ liệu thô, hãy tạo một bảng có tên thông tin. Bảng thông tin nên có các cột sau
yap. Chỉ hai lĩnh vực. Tôi đang cố giữ mọi thứ đơn giản ở đây. Vì vậy, hãy chuyển sang bước tiếp theo
Tạo một tệp có tên là chỉ mục. php và dán vào đó đoạn mã sau
Nếu bạn lưu và mở trang web trên trình duyệt của mình, bạn sẽ nhận được kết quả như thế này Doesn't look like the best form in the world right? Let's fix that. Add this line directly below the
Đó là liên kết để tải kiểu từ tệp biểu định kiểu. Hãy tạo các phong cách. css và thêm mã kiểu dáng này vào đó
Bây giờ hãy kiểm tra lại biểu mẫu của chúng tôi trong trình duyệt Cái đó tốt hơn. Tôi thường muốn tách mã HTML của mình khỏi mã PHP càng nhiều càng tốt. Tôi coi đó là thông lệ tốt. Trên lưu ý đó, hãy tạo một tệp khác có tên php_code. php nơi chúng tôi triển khai tất cả các chức năng của php như kết nối với cơ sở dữ liệu, truy vấn cơ sở dữ liệu và những thứ tương tự Vì vậy, hãy mở php_code. php và dán đoạn mã sau vào đó
Bây giờ hãy thêm tệp này vào đầu (dòng đầu tiên) của chỉ mục của bạn. tập tin php. như vậy
Tại thời điểm này, tất cả những gì mã này thực hiện là kết nối với cơ sở dữ liệu, khởi tạo một số biến và lưu dữ liệu đã gửi từ biểu mẫu vào cơ sở dữ liệu trong thông tin chúng tôi đã tạo trước đó. Đó chỉ là phần CREATE của CRUD. Hãy tiếp tục với những người khác Now visit again your index.php file and add this code right under the
Mã này hiển thị thông báo xác nhận để cho người dùng biết rằng một bản ghi mới đã được tạo trong cơ sở dữ liệu. Để truy xuất các bản ghi cơ sở dữ liệu và hiển thị chúng trên trang, hãy thêm mã này ngay phía trên biểu mẫu nhập liệu
Hãy tạo một bản ghi mới và xem công cụ này có hoạt động không và Voila. Nó hoạt động hoàn hảo Bây giờ chúng ta chuyển sang chỉnh sửa. Ở đầu chỉ mục của bạn. php (ngay sau câu lệnh bao gồm) thêm đoạn mã sau
Khi chỉnh sửa một bản ghi cơ sở dữ liệu, chúng ta cần đưa các giá trị cũ vào biểu mẫu để chúng có thể được sửa đổi. Để làm như vậy, hãy sửa đổi các trường đầu vào của chúng tôi trên biểu mẫu và đặt các giá trị được lấy từ cơ sở dữ liệu ($name, $address) làm giá trị cho thuộc tính value của các trường biểu mẫu Ngoài ra, hãy thêm một trường ẩn để giữ id của bản ghi mà chúng tôi sẽ cập nhật để nó có thể được nhận dạng duy nhất trong cơ sở dữ liệu bởi id của nó. Điều này giải thích nó tốt hơn ________số 8Remember all of that is in the input |